To calculate estimated energy needs using the equations developed by the food and nutrition board, one needs information about t
Alika [10]
I believe one needs information about the individual's Age, Weight, Height, and Gender. 
The Dietary reference intakes define the daily requirement for energy as Estimated Energy requirement. The EER is based on calculations that account for an individual's energy intake, energy expenditure, age, sex, weight, height, and physical activity level.
